BEST FACE PRIMER:
Benefit The Porefessional ($30, Sephora)
This is my favorite primer because it camouflages pores while helping your makeup last all day. It is very silky and glides on the skin smoothly. I only use this when I wear foundation, and I take a tiny dab and apply it just to my t-zone before I apply the foundation.

BEST CONCEALER:
MAC Pro Longwear Concealer (19, MAC)
This concealer is amazing and soo multi-purpose. It comes in a little glass bottle with a little pump. You can use this to mix with moisturizer for a tinted moisturizer with a flawless finish, you can use it under your eyes, and you can also use it for blemishes. It is creamy, it doesn’t crease, and it never looks cakey. I wear shade NW15.
BEST POWDER:
MAC Studio Fix Powder Plus Foundation ($27, MAC)
I have been using this powder for years. Technically, it is a powder foundation, so it gives more coverage than the average setting powder. I used this when I wear tinted moisturizer (which is almost every day!) and it just gives me a little more coverage without looking cakey. I wear shade NW20.
BEST BRONZER/CONTOUR
Benefit Hoola ($28, Sephora)
This is a matte bronzer that is perfect for fairer skin tones like myself. This is lighter than Nars Laguna bronzer, which I used for years. I like this bronzer because it is a cool toned brown, so it works good with my skin tone. I can also use this to contour with because there is no shimmer in it.

BEST HIGHLIGHTER:
The Balm Mary Loumanizer ($24, Nordstrom)
This is my favorite highlighting powder to use. It is a light golden highlight that gives you the prettiest glow when applied to the tops of your cheekbones. You get a lot of product, so this will last you forever, and a little bit goes a long way.
